X-Git-Url: https://gerrit.automotivelinux.org/gerrit/gitweb?a=blobdiff_plain;f=src%2FCMakeLists.txt;h=fda32c1bbcac1ddd712ea748ef1658cbe20b2b80;hb=8c712205657ceceb8644065735b5fff06bedfbb5;hp=aa1c2a0bf20bef08d694624f73de80ab7d3ef68c;hpb=59e0e42d7f612f4e9f526a0632a86dc0300ad76f;p=staging%2Fwindowmanager.git diff --git a/src/CMakeLists.txt b/src/CMakeLists.txt index aa1c2a0..fda32c1 100644 --- a/src/CMakeLists.txt +++ b/src/CMakeLists.txt @@ -1,4 +1,3 @@ -wlproto(IVI_APP ivi-application) wlproto(IVI_CON ivi-controller) add_executable(winman @@ -7,7 +6,6 @@ add_executable(winman wayland.hpp util.c util.h - ${IVI_APP_PROTO} ${IVI_CON_PROTO}) target_compile_definitions(winman @@ -15,18 +13,24 @@ target_compile_definitions(winman WINMAN_VERSION_STRING="${PACKAGE_VERSION}" _GNU_SOURCE) # XXX should I define this here?! +if(${CMAKE_BUILD_TYPE} STREQUAL "Debug") + target_compile_definitions(winman + PRIVATE + _GLIBCXX_DEBUG) +endif() + target_compile_options(winman PRIVATE -Wall -Wextra -Wno-unused-parameter -Wno-comment) set_target_properties(winman PROPERTIES + INTERPROCEDURAL_OPTIMIZATION ON + CXX_EXTENSIONS OFF CXX_STANDARD 14 - CXX_STANDARD_REQUIRED ON) + CXX_STANDARD_REQUIRED ON -set_target_properties(winman - PROPERTIES C_EXTENSIONS OFF C_STANDARD 99 C_STANDARD_REQUIRED ON)